Analyzing the Closet's Condition



When beginning the reconstruction procedure, begin by assessing the condition of the antique cupboard. Meticulously analyze the general framework for any type of indicators of damage such as cracks, chips, or loose joints. Check cabinet refinishing services for any rot, warping, or insect invasion that might have happened with time. It's vital to determine the degree of the reconstruction required before continuing better.

Next off, examine the closet's hardware such as hinges, knobs, and locks. Make note of any missing pieces or components that require repair service or replacement. Make sure that all equipment is operating correctly and safely attached to the closet.

Furthermore, assess the closet's coating. Look for any type of scrapes, discolorations, or staining that may influence the visual appeal. Identify if the coating needs to be stripped and reapplied or if a straightforward touch-up will certainly be sufficient.

Implementing the Repair Refine



To successfully perform the repair process on your antique closet, start by thoroughly cleaning up the surface area with the timber cleaner. This action is vital as it aids get rid of years of dust, crud, and old gloss that may have collected externally.

As soon as the closet is tidy and dry, examine the problem of the wood. Seek any kind of cracks, scrapes, or various other problems that require to be attended to. Use wood filler to fix any blemishes, ensuring to match the filler color to the timber tone for a seamless finish.



After the repair work have actually dried out, carefully sand the whole surface area to create a smooth and even base for the new surface. Be careful not to sand as well aggressively, as you don't want to harm the wood below.

Once the sanding is complete, apply a wood tarnish or end up of your option, following the maker's guidelines. Enable the finish to completely dry totally before applying a safety leading coat to guarantee the longevity of your recovered antique cabinet.
